Autism Insurance Reform Resources for Self-Insured Companies
Companies that provide employees with self-insured health insurance plans (coverage under which claims are paid for with the company's own funds) are not governed by state law.  Find out how to begin a campaign for coverage of autism therapies at your self-insured company.

Cost Estimate Studies of State Autism Insurance Reform Bills
Autism Speaks engaged a leading independent actuarial firm, Oliver Wyman Group, to develop a robust cost model and cost estimates for various state autism insurance reform bills.
